WebJun 16, 2009 · As such, the world’s peat bogs represent an important “carbon sink”—a place where CO 2 is stored below ground and can’t escape into the atmosphere and exacerbate global warming. WebJan 11, 2024 · Scientists have calculated that peat digging on Thorne Moors near Doncaster caused about 16.6 million tonnes of carbon to leak to the atmosphere from the 16th century onwards.
